数据备份与恢复完全指南:备份策略、方法选择与恢复演练

文章最后更新时间:2026-05-28 13:34:43

引言

数据备份是保障业务连续性的关键措施。无论是硬件故障、人为误操作还是恶意攻击,都可能导致数据丢失。建立完善的备份恢复体系,可以在数据丢失时快速恢复,将损失降到最低。本文将全面介绍数据备份的策略、方法和最佳实践。

备份策略

备份类型

常见的备份类型包括全量备份、增量备份和差异备份。全量备份是备份所有数据,恢复速度快但占用存储空间大。增量备份只备份上次备份后变化的数据,节省存储空间但恢复时需要多个备份集。差异备份只备份上次全量备份后变化的数据,介于全量和增量之间。企业要根据数据量、变化频率和恢复需求选择合适的备份类型。建议采用全量备份与增量备份相结合的策略。

备份频率

备份频率要根据数据的重要性和变化频率来确定。核心业务数据建议每天备份,甚至每小时备份。一般业务数据可以每周备份。静态数据可以每月备份。备份频率要在数据安全和存储成本之间取得平衡。建议制定备份日历,明确各类数据的备份时间和责任人。备份频率要根据业务变化定期调整。

备份存储

备份数据的存储位置很重要。建议采用3-2-1备份原则:至少保留3份数据副本,使用2种不同的存储介质,其中1份存放在异地。本地备份用于快速恢复,异地备份用于灾难恢复。云存储是异地备份的理想选择,具有成本低、可靠性高的优势。备份数据要加密存储,防止数据泄露。

备份方法

数据库备份

数据库是最重要的数据资产,需要特别关注备份。MySQL支持mysqldump逻辑备份和xtrabackup物理备份。mysqldump适合小型数据库,备份文件是SQL文本。xtrabackup适合大型数据库,支持热备份和增量备份。PostgreSQL支持pg_dump逻辑备份和WAL归档物理备份。数据库备份要定期验证可恢复性,确保备份数据的完整性。

文件备份

文件备份包括网站文件、配置文件和用户数据等。文件备份可以使用rsync、tar等工具。rsync支持增量备份和远程同步,效率高且节省带宽。tar可以将多个文件打包压缩,方便存储和传输。文件备份要注意保留文件权限和属性。建议使用自动化脚本定期执行文件备份。

系统备份

系统备份包括操作系统和应用程序的配置。系统备份可以使用快照、镜像等方式。云服务器的快照功能可以快速创建系统状态的备份。系统备份可以在系统故障时快速恢复,避免重新安装和配置的麻烦。建议在系统变更前后都创建快照备份。

恢复演练

定期演练

备份恢复演练是验证备份有效性的唯一方法。建议每季度进行一次恢复演练,验证备份数据的完整性和可恢复性。演练内容包括数据库恢复、文件恢复和系统恢复。演练过程中要记录恢复时间和遇到的问题。通过演练发现备份策略的不足,及时优化改进。

数据备份是业务连续性的最后保障。希望本文的介绍能够帮助企业建立完善的备份恢复体系,确保数据安全。

© 版权声明
THE END
喜欢就支持一下吧
点赞14 分享
评论 抢沙发

请登录后发表评论

    暂无评论内容